Album title? Home

Where did the title of your new album come from? I’ve spent most of the last five years either touring or working in Southern Afghanistan. Now I’m home – the domestic frontier is not without its challenges.

How long did it take to write/record? I started recording with Shane O’Mara in November 2012 and finished it last month. Most of the songs are new but others I have been saving up for a more personal album like this.

Was anything in particular inspiring you during the making? We’ve all got a certain amount of restlessness to face down or accommodate before settling down to build a life. The transition can be involved, but pleasurable if you can pull it off.

Will you do anything differently next time? No, the writing came out organically enough, the recording process was lovely and I took my time. Listeners say they like it.
